Devtools Must Be Open Source

TL;DR

A prominent industry group has announced a push for all developer tools to become open source. The initiative aims to improve transparency, security, and collaboration in software development. The proposal is gaining support but faces resistance from some commercial vendors.

An industry coalition has formally announced a campaign calling for all developer tools to be open source, emphasizing transparency and security benefits. This initiative, led by several prominent open source advocates and organizations, aims to influence policy and industry standards. The move comes amid ongoing debates about the advantages of open versus proprietary software tools in development environments.

The coalition, comprising open source advocates, developers, and some industry leaders, issued a statement on April 15, 2024, urging companies and organizations to open source their developer tools. They argue that open source tools enable better security through community scrutiny, foster innovation through collaborative development, and improve transparency for users and developers alike. The campaign has gained initial support from several open source foundations and independent developers, but faces opposition from some commercial tool vendors who prefer to keep their tools proprietary for competitive reasons.

According to the coalition’s spokesperson, Jane Doe, “Making developer tools open source will democratize software development, increase trust, and accelerate innovation.” The movement is also motivated by recent security incidents linked to closed-source tools, which some argue could have been mitigated with open collaboration. However, representatives from major proprietary tool companies have expressed concern about intellectual property rights and revenue models, complicating widespread adoption.

Implications for Software Development Industry

This initiative could significantly impact how developer tools are created, distributed, and maintained. If adopted widely, open sourcing all developer tools might lead to increased security through community review, faster bug fixes, and more customizable solutions. It could also challenge existing business models based on proprietary software sales, prompting a shift toward service-based or open source revenue strategies. For developers and organizations, this could mean greater transparency and control over their development environments, but also potential risks related to support and stability if proprietary vendors withdraw from open source commitments.

Background of Open Source Advocacy and Industry Resistance

The push for open source developer tools is rooted in a broader movement advocating transparency, security, and collaborative innovation in software. Historically, many core development tools and libraries have been open source, but a significant portion of commercial tools remain proprietary. Recent security vulnerabilities and supply chain attacks have intensified calls for open source solutions, as community scrutiny can lead to quicker identification of issues. Conversely, some industry players argue that proprietary tools provide necessary protections for intellectual property and sustain business models that fund ongoing development. The debate has been ongoing for years, but this latest campaign marks a notable escalation with formal advocacy and industry backing.

Uncertain Impact and Industry Response

It is not yet clear how many companies will commit to open sourcing their developer tools in response to this campaign. The movement has gained support from some open source advocates, but resistance from major proprietary vendors remains, and the actual industry-wide impact is still uncertain. Additionally, questions remain about how support, maintenance, and security will be managed in a fully open ecosystem, and whether the initiative will lead to regulatory or policy changes.

Key Questions

What are the main benefits of open sourcing developer tools?

Open sourcing developer tools can improve transparency, security through community review, foster innovation, and allow for greater customization by users and developers.

Which companies are supporting this initiative?

Several open source foundations and independent developers have expressed support, but major proprietary tool vendors have not officially endorsed the campaign.

Could open sourcing all developer tools harm companies’ revenue models?

Yes, some industry leaders argue that removing proprietary restrictions could impact revenue; however, advocates believe new business models based on services and support could compensate.

What are the risks of fully open source developer tools?

Potential risks include reduced control over the development process, support challenges, and possible security issues if open contributions are not properly managed.
